What options are available in this field of surgery?

Every part of the facial structure can be affected by plastic surgery. It is a broad term that involves working on skin, tissue, and the underlying bone to improve the shape of the face. You can enhance a recessed chin or a flat cheek, or accentuate sagging jawlines and rounded brows to improve your facial appearance. Cosmetic surgery includes a wide range of procedures, from lip augmentation, which makes the lips look fuller, through to hair transplantation, dermabrasion, which uses chemicals to improve the surface of the skin and give it a more youthful appearance. According to the procedure, facial plastic surgery may be an extensive operation requiring several days in hospital or it can be minor with minimal downtime and can be performed at a clinic.

What is the best way to choose a doctor for this type of surgery?

A surgeon must be qualified to perform all types of cosmetic surgeries. The surgeon should be certified by a large organization, such as American Body of Plastic Surgeons. A large medical institution or hospital should accredit them. Good plastic surgeons also have several years’ experience in general surgery. It is important to consider the reputation of the plastic surgeon when determining whether this type of surgery will be successful.

How do you prepare for a facial plastic surgery in the most common way?

Each surgeon prepares the patient for surgery in their own unique way. However, the initial step is to determine if the person qualifies for the operation. Qualified surgeons can determine the best procedure for a patient based on a variety of factors, including medical history, skin conditions, anatomical features, and physical exams. The surgeon may ask the patient to quit smoking before the procedure if they are used to it.
